Welcome to the B-Tree and B+Tree Visualization project! This repository hosts a collaborative effort to implement visually engaging and interactive visualizations of B-Tree and B+Tree structures. The goal is to provide a comprehensive learning resource for understanding these fundamental data structures. This project is implemented as the CS4488 Capstone Project at Idaho State University.
B-Trees and B+Trees are self-balancing tree data structures widely used in databases and file systems for efficient storage and retrieval of data. This project aims to create intuitive visualizations that showcase the dynamic behavior of these trees during various operations such as insertion, deletion, and search.
- Visualize B-Tree and B+Tree operations
- Allow user selection of the degree of the tree for B+Tree
- Differentiate between non-leaf and leaf nodes
- Animated representation of changes during tree operations
